How Abacus Learning Enhances Brain Connectivity and Cognitive Skills
Abacus learning is a powerful tool that not only boosts mathematical abilities but also significantly enhances brain connectivity and cognitive skills. The scientific principles behind abacus training are grounded in its ability to engage multiple brain regions simultaneously.
🧠 Stimulates Both Brain Hemispheres
Abacus training for children engages both the left and right hemispheres of the brain. The left hemisphere, responsible for logic and math, is activated when solving equations, while the right hemisphere, responsible for spatial awareness, is stimulated as children visualize and manipulate the beads. This dual engagement enhances overall brain connectivity and cognitive function.
🔄 Promotes Neuroplasticity
Neuroplasticity, the brain’s ability to form new neural connections, is greatly supported by abacus learning. As children practice abacus skills, they build new pathways in the brain, improving memory, concentration, and problem-solving abilities. This adaptability helps children to process information faster and more effectively in other learning contexts.
